Zoom Resources
Here are a couple of tips, considerations, and clarifications:
1. The instructions and guidance that you've seen in my videos were based on our school issued Chromebooks. The app was pushed out to student Chromebooks and also made available to download in the Chrome Web Store if they did not get it.
2. While the app is not always necessary, you will find that zoom works much better on most phones with the Zoom app. The same can be said for iPads. If using a personal device rather than a school device, I'd recommend using the app.
3. Zoom is an excellent tool. It is helpful and easy to use. It has been a tremendous help to us thus far. With that being said, we've had little time to analyze Zoom's privacy and security policies. My recommendation to you is to only sign in using your school email (not Facebook). Students do not need to create accounts to participate and I would not recommend that they do. In short, share as little information as possible.
Notice from Castle Learning
We are seeing online learning picking up considerable momentum as reflected in the extremely high user volumes we are experiencing on Castle Learning. Unfortunately, at times, high usage is causing slow response times within the application, which can be very frustrating for teachers and students working to create and complete activities. We are seeing peak activity between 11:00 a.m. and 4:00 p.m., and faster response times outside of that window.
We apologize for the inconvenience and are working quickly to boost performance of the environment. This will be an ongoing effort over the next several days and we will provide updates on our progress.
We greatly appreciate your use of Castle Learning and your patience as we absorb the increase in volume.
